Layout funding is a kind of temporary loan that is repaid in 30 to 90 days, the moment it generally takes to sell an auto. A regular brand-new automobile costs a supplier regarding $5 to $10 in interest daily. So if a car rests on the whole lot for thirty days, the dealership will be charged $150 - $300 in passion settlements.
Many suppliers repay these financing expenses through what is called "". This is usually 2 - 3% of the invoice rate of the car. On a typical $28,000 vehicle, a 2% holdback would amount to around $550. If the supplier markets this cars and truck in 1 month and incurs financing prices of $300, then they will earn a profit of $250 on the holdback.

In the United States. https://urlscan.io/result/019768e0-2c76-776a-8642-30938012abd9/, automobile dealers have actually historically been a vital source of state and neighborhood sales taxes. They have considerable political influence and have lobbied for guidelines that assure their survival and productivity. By 2010, all US states had legislations that banned suppliers from side-stepping independent vehicle dealers and selling vehicles directly to customers.
Economists have identified these regulations as a form of rent-seeking that removes rents from makers of autos, increases expenses for consumers, and limitations entry of brand-new auto dealers while raising earnings for incumbent automobile dealerships. ron marhofer nissan. Study reveals that as a result of these regulations, market prices for vehicles are more than they or else would be
Today, straight sales by a car manufacturer to consumers are restricted by the majority of states in the U.S. through franchise business legislations that require brand-new cars and trucks to be sold just by licensed and bonded, individually possessed car dealerships.
In feedback, Tesla has actually opened city centre galleries where prospective consumers can check out autos that can only be ordered online. These shops were inspired by the Apple Stores. Tesla's version was the very first of its kind, and has given them distinct benefits as a brand-new cars and truck business. nissan. In economic theory, automobile dealerships can be defined as franchisees and auto manufacturers as franchisors.

The franchisor can act opportunistically by imposing restraints and problem on the franchisee after the last has actually incurred sunk costs, such as spending in physical possessions and developing an online reputation with consumers. The franchisor can for example call for that cars be marketed at small cost, and solutions be executed for little payment.
Car car dealerships have actually lobbied for regulations that browse around these guys increase the survival and productivity of car dealerships: By 2010, all US states had regulations that prohibited producers from side-stepping independent vehicle dealerships and selling vehicles to consumers straight. By 2009, many states enforced limitations on the production of new dealerships to take on incumbent dealers.

The majority of state laws call for upon the discontinuation of a dealer that manufacturers redeem the supply, and special equipment and in many cases pay the rental fee of the dealership's facilities. The issuance of brand-new car dealership licenses can be based on geographical restriction; if there is currently a dealership for a firm in an area, no one else can open one.

In the European Union, cars and truck producers were permitted from 1985 to 2006 to participate in contracts with cars and truck dealerships that restricted what sort of automobiles dealerships were allowed to market. Cars and truck suppliers were able "to enforce qualitative, measurable and geographical restrictions on supply by offering their vehicles just with a limited variety of dealers bound by stringent franchise business agreements." In 2006, the European Compensation established that it was anti-competitive for vehicle suppliers to restrict dealers from lugging multiple cars and truck brand names.Internet use has urged this niche solution to expand and get to the general customer industry.
